Description

This detached single-family home from the 1910s impresses with its distinctive style, solid structure, and diverse development potential. Known as “Villa Bavaria,” the property sits on a plot of approx. 541 m² and combines traditional craftsmanship with the opportunity for an individualized redesign. The exterior is characterized by typical features of the Heimatstil, such as the striking mansard roof, a round-arched entrance portal with decorative plaster painting, and original wooden shutters. The solid brick construction underscores the high building quality of this era. The house currently offers about 137 m² of living space, spread over two full floors. The attic is partially finished and still offers considerable potential for additional living space. With appropriate modernization, additional bedrooms, a studio, or a home office could be created here. However, the property is in an unrenovated condition and requires comprehensive gut renovation, including heating, electrical systems, insulation, windows, and sanitary installations. For investors or people with an eye for style and quality, this offers a solid basis with authentic character. Development is governed by Section 34 of the German Federal Building Code (BauGB). Due to the surrounding neighboring buildings with two full floors plus attic, there are generally options for expansion or new construction, depending on preferences and in consultation with the building authority. Location: Grafing, Bavaria

Grafing near Munich is one of the most sought-after places to live in the southeastern surrounding area of the state capital. The town offers a perfect combination of high quality of life, established infrastructure and excellent connections—ideal for anyone who wants to live close to nature yet still be in the city quickly. Particularly noteworthy is the transport location: Grafing Bahnhof station is an important regional transport hub and can be reached in only about 3 minutes by car. From here, regional trains take you directly to Munich East Station in only about 13 minutes. In addition, S-Bahn line S4 (from Grafing Stadt) regularly connects the town with Munich’s city center as well as nearby Ebersberg. Federal Highway B304 also provides quick access to the A94 and A8 motorways. Grafing has very good local amenities with numerous shopping options, doctors, pharmacies, banks, and a wide range of education and childcare services—from day-care centers to a grammar school. The charming town center with its weekly market, cafés, small specialist shops and events creates a lively yet down-to-earth atmosphere. Grafing also impresses with a wide-ranging leisure and sports offering: whether tennis, riding, football or cycling— the options are diverse. Thanks to its proximity to the Alpine foothills, there are also many opportunities for trips to the mountains, for hiking, skiing or swimming in the Upper Bavarian lakes.
